Before I retired I use to walk across the street to a Wendyās burger joint. Over several years I collected a few extra ketchup cups each time I went there for lunch. I probably have a thousand or more still. I tried using the medical cups like you have, but it has three little stand offs molded into the bottom so the cups donāt get stuck together. I would hit those stupid things with my mixing stick and wind up flicking paint out of the cup. Ketchup cups are smooth bottom inside. Look closer at pics 3 & 5. Not even a J model. I read somewhere thatās a C or a D painted up to look like a BA. Very inaccurate paint job. I think 4 is a computer generated pic. Some of yours are good pics that was adding to the confusion. I did find a YouTube video or two today that shows exactly what I needed. The coroguard is a small area on the LE, not all the way to the panel lines like that display C or D model. Note the non slatted stabilizer. Your pics are the ones I saw that created all my confusion along with the incorrect painting guide in the Hasegawa 1/48 kit. (I say incorrect. Incorrect for the 1969 BA birds.).
